Workers who clean vehicles used for public transportation, <br />government services, and Critical Sectors. <br />Public works and infrastructure support services. This category is limited <br />to public works and infrastructure support services workers listed in the <br />Updated CISA Guidance, in addition to construction material suppliers and <br />workers providing services necessary to maintain construction material <br />sources. <br />h. Communications and information technology. This category is limited to <br />communications and information technology workers listed in the Updated <br />CISA Guidance and all workers who support news services of all kinds, <br />including newspapers, radio, television, and other forms of news media. <br />i. Other community -based government operations and essential functions. <br />This category is limited to the other community -based and government <br />essential functions listed in the Updated CISA Guidance, in addition to <br />workers who support the following functions and services: <br />i. Election support services and election administration workers. <br />ii. Housing, shelter, and homelessness -prevention staff of state and local <br />agencies and organizations responsible for ensuring safe and stable <br />housing, including workers from state and local agencies and <br />organizations with responsibility for ensuring safe and stable housing; <br />shelter outreach or drop -in center programs; financing affordable <br />housing; and administering rent subsidies, homeless interventions, <br />operating supports, and similar supports. This includes workers <br />necessary to provide repairs, maintenance, and operations support to <br />residential dwellings. <br />iii. Workers performing all other governmental functions which are <br />necessary to ensure the health, safety, and welfare of the public, to <br />preserve the essential elements of the financial system of government, <br />and to continue priority services as determined by a political <br />subdivision of the State. All political subdivisions of the State will <br />determine the minimum personnel necessary to maintain these <br />governmental operations. <br />iv. Workers supporting building code enforcement necessary to maintain <br />public safety and health and for all ongoing construction. <br />v. Workers, including logistical and contract workers, who are critical to <br />facilitating support of national, state, and local emergency response <br />operations. <br />
